AI Summary

A report citing Russia's state news agency RIA claims 12 deaths from a drone strike on a student dormitory in Russian-controlled Luhansk, Ukraine. The story presents a casualty figure from the Russian government without additional verification or context. The incomplete description suggests minimal elaboration on the incident's details.
